org.apache.jasper.runtime
Class JspFactoryImpl

java.lang.Object
  extended byjavax.servlet.jsp.JspFactory
      extended byorg.apache.jasper.runtime.JspFactoryImpl

public class JspFactoryImpl
extends javax.servlet.jsp.JspFactory

Implementation of JspFactory from the spec. Helps create PageContext and other animals.

Author:
Anil K. Vijendran

Nested Class Summary
protected  class JspFactoryImpl.PrivilegedGetPageContext
           
protected  class JspFactoryImpl.PrivilegedReleasePageContext
           
 
Constructor Summary
JspFactoryImpl()
           
 
Method Summary
 javax.servlet.jsp.JspEngineInfo getEngineInfo()
           
 javax.servlet.jsp.PageContext getPageContext(javax.servlet.Servlet servlet, jav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, java.lang.String errorPageURL, boolean needsSession, int bufferSize, boolean autoflush)
           
protected  javax.servlet.jsp.PageContext internalGetPageContext(javax.servlet.Servlet servlet, javax.servlet.ServletRequest request, javax.servlet.ServletResponse response, java.lang.String errorPageURL, boolean needsSession, int bufferSize, boolean autoflush)
           
 void releasePageContext(javax.servlet.jsp.PageContext pc)
           
 
Methods inherited from class javax.servlet.jsp.JspFactory
getDefaultFactory, setDefaultFactory
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JspFactoryImpl

public JspFactoryImpl()
Method Detail

getPageContext

public javax.servlet.jsp.PageContext getPageContext(javax.servlet.Servlet servlet,
                                                    javax.servlet.ServletRequest request,
                                                    javax.servlet.ServletResponse response,
                                                    java.lang.String errorPageURL,
                                                    boolean needsSession,
                                                    int bufferSize,
                                                    boolean autoflush)

internalGetPageContext

protected javax.servlet.jsp.PageContext internalGetPageContext(javax.servlet.Servlet servlet,
                                                               javax.servlet.ServletRequest request,
                                                               javax.servlet.ServletResponse response,
                                                               java.lang.String errorPageURL,
                                                               boolean needsSession,
                                                               int bufferSize,
                                                               boolean autoflush)

releasePageContext

public void releasePageContext(javax.servlet.jsp.PageContext pc)

getEngineInfo

public javax.servlet.jsp.JspEngineInfo getEngineInfo()


Copyright 2000 Apache Software Foundation. All Rights Reserved.